Understanding Duplicate Content
What is Duplicate Content?
Duplicate content refers to blocks of text or other media that appear in numerous places throughout the web. This can happen both within your own site (internal duplication) or throughout different domains (external duplication). Online search engine punish websites with excessive replicate content since it complicates their indexing process.
Why Does Google Consider Replicate Content?
Google focuses on user experience above all else. If users continuously stumble upon similar pieces of material from different sources, their experience suffers. As a result, Google aims to offer special details that adds value rather than recycling existing material.

What is one of the most Typical Repair for Replicate Content?
The most typical repair includes identifying duplicates using tools such as Google Browse Console or other SEO software application services. As soon as determined, you can either reword the duplicated areas or execute 301 redirects to point users to the original content.

2. How do I inspect if I have duplicate content?
You can use tools like Copyscape or Siteliner which scan your website versus others offered online and recognize circumstances of duplication.
3. Are there charges for having duplicate content?
Yes, online search engine may penalize websites with excessive replicate material by decreasing their ranking in search results page or perhaps de-indexing them altogether.
4. What are canonical tags used for?
Canonical tags inform online search engine about which variation of a page should be prioritized when several versions exist, therefore preventing confusion over duplicates.
